Description
Yew Tree Cottage is a mid-18th century cottage constructed of flint with red brick dressings and lacing courses. It features a ripped thatched roof with a catslide over the outshot at the rear and a central ridge stack. The cottage has a lobby entrance design and stands two storeys high. On the first floor, there are two 20th-century casement windows, while the ground floor also has two 20th-century casement windows, which are flanked by a central boarded door. This door is accompanied by a 20th-century rustic timber and thatched gabled porch, and the windows have segmental relieving arches and boarded shutters.
